Pedro Schestatsky is a scholar working on Physiology, Neurology and Neurology. According to data from OpenAlex, Pedro Schestatsky has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Physiology, 17 papers in Neurology and 15 papers in Neurology. Recurrent topics in Pedro Schestatsky’s work include Pain Mechanisms and Treatments (14 papers),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ation Studies (14 papers) and Botulinum Toxin and Related Neurological Disorders (11 papers). Pedro Schestatsky is often cited by papers focused on Pain Mechanisms and Treatments (14 papers),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ation Studies (14 papers) and Botulinum Toxin and Related Neurological Disorders (11 papers). Pedro Schestatsky coll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, Spain and United States. Pedro Schestatsky's co-authors include Josep Valls‐Solé, Felipe Fregni, Carlos Roberto de Mello Rieder, Jordi Casanova‐Mollá and Wolnei Caumo and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Neurology and Pain.
